Details
A vulnerability has been found in Netcore/Netis Router up to 2014 and classified as critical. Affected by this vulnerability is an unknown functionality of the component UDP Handler. The manipulation with an unknown input leads to a backdoor vulnerability. The CWE definition for the vulnerability is CWE-912. The product contains functionality that is not documented, not part of the specification, and not accessible through an interface or command sequence that is obvious to the product's users or administrators. As an impact it is known to affect confidentiality, integrity, and availability. The summary by CVE is:
A remote code execution vulnerability exists in multiple Netcore and Netis routers models with firmware released prior to August 2014 due to the presence of an undocumented backdoor listener on UDP port 53413. Exact version boundaries remain undocumented. An unauthenticated remote attacker can send specially crafted UDP packets to execute arbitrary commands on the affected device. This backdoor uses a hardcoded authentication mechanism and accepts shell commands post-authentication. Some device models include a non-standard implementation of the `echo` command, which may affect exploitability.
The weakness was presented by Trend Micro Trendlabs. It is possible to read the advisory at web.archive.org. This vulnerability is known as CVE-2025-34117 since 04/15/2025. The exploitation appears to be easy. The attack can be launched remotely. The exploitation doesn't need any form of authentication. Technical details are unknown but a public exploit is available. The attack technique deployed by this issue is T1588.001 according to MITRE ATT&CK.
It is possible to download the exploit at exploit-db.com. It is declared as proof-of-concept.
Proper firewalling of is able to address this issue.
